Last October, Harrison Browne made history. A forward for the Buffalo Beauts, he announced he is transgender, and in the process became the first athlete in professional team sports to do so as an active player.

Vancouver Canucks fans jump in to finish national anthems after singer’s mic cuts out National Post Blues musician Jim Byrnes, a St. Louis native and Vancouver resident, was performing the U.S. national anthem before the Canucks’ game against the Blues when his microphone cut out shortly before the end.
